Reverse Posted Reconciliation
Business Value
A bank transaction that was reconciled incorrectly can be reversed through the posted payment reconciliation in standard Microsoft Dynamics 365 Business Central. That cleans up the postings – but the bank transaction itself stays marked as already processed at the banking service. It is therefore not delivered again on the next retrieval, and a correct reconciliation is only possible manually.
With this feature, the bank transaction is released for re-import when the reconciliation is reversed. The operation can therefore be reconciled again from scratch.
Feature Description
The reversal itself is performed through the standard action of the posted payment reconciliation. In addition, 365 business Banking resets the affected bank transactions at the banking service, so that they are delivered again the next time bank transactions are retrieved.
The posted payment reconciliation line carries the Is Reversed field. It indicates whether the transaction has been reversed in this posted payment reconciliation.
Releasing a transaction afterwards
In case a transaction is needed again independently of a reversal, the Reset Transaction action is available in the posted payment reconciliation. It releases the selected bank transactions for re-import; afterwards you retrieve the bank transactions again.
Connected bank accounts only
Only transactions of bank accounts that are connected as a bank account through 365 business Banking can be reset. This is not possible for payment service providers or for bank accounts without a connection – in that case the action reports that the selection contains no bank transactions that can be released for re-import.
